The Importance of Healthy Eating

Before delving into the world of quick and nutritious recipes, let’s take a moment to understand why healthy eating is crucial for our overall well-being. A balanced diet rich in nutrients fuels our bodies and supports optimal physical and mental function. The benefits of healthy eating are numerous:

  • Increased Energy: Nutrient-dense foods provide sustained energy levels throughout the day, keeping fatigue at bay and boosting productivity.
  • Weight Management: Eating various nutritious foods can help keep your weight in check and lower the chance of developing health issues related to obesity.
  • Enhanced Mood: Certain nutrients, such as omega-3 fatty acids and complex carbohydrates, have been linked to improved mood and reduced risk of depression.
  • Robust Immune System: Consuming a diet that is abundant in vitamins is beneficial for overall health., minerals and antioxidants fortify the immune system, aiding the body in its battle against infections and illnesses.
  • Improved Digestion: A high-fibre diet supports digestive health, preventing constipation and promoting a healthy gut.

Incorporating Healthy Eating into Your Lifestyle

Adopting a healthy eating lifestyle doesn’t have to involve drastic changes overnight. Minor, sustainable modifications can make a significant difference over time. Here are some tips to help you transition to a healthier way of eating:

  1. Plan: Set aside weekly time to plan your meals and snacks. This reduces the temptation to grab unhealthy options when hunger strikes.
  2. Stock Nutrient-Rich Foods: Keep your pantry and fridge filled with wholesome ingredients like whole grains, lean proteins, fresh fruits, and vegetables.
  3. Practice Portion Control: To prevent overeating, paying attention to the size of your portions is essential. Opting for smaller plates and bowls can assist you in consuming less food without thinking about it.
  4. Stay Hydrated: Drinking plenty of water supports digestion, regulates body temperature, and helps control cravings.
  5. Limit Processed Foods: Foods that have been processed frequently contain unhealthy amounts of fats, sugars, and sodium. Opt for whole foods whenever possible.
  6. Enjoy Balanced Meals: Aim for a balanced protein, healthy fats, complex carbohydrates, and fibre in each meal to keep you satisfied and nourished.

Mediterranean Chickpea Salad: This refreshing salad combines protein-rich chickpeas with vibrant vegetables and a zesty olive oil and lemon dressing. It’s a perfect option for a light and satisfying lunch.

Ingredients:

  • 1 can of chickpeas, drained and rinsed
  • Cucumber, diced
  • Cherry tomatoes, halved.
  • Red onion, finely chopped
  • Kalamata olives, pitted and sliced
  • Fresh parsley, chopped.
  • Feta cheese, crumbled
  • Olive oil
  • Lemon juice
  • Salt and pepper to taste

Instructions:

  1. Combine chickpeas, cucumber, tomatoes, red onion, olives, and parsley in a large bowl.
  2. Drizzle with olive oil and lemon juice. Toss to combine.
  3. Sprinkle feta cheese on top and season with salt and pepper.
  4. Enjoy it as a light meal or a side dish.
  5. Sheet Pan Baked Salmon and Vegetables:

This recipe simplifies cooking by using a sheet pan. It’s a wholesome and flavorful option that requires minimal cleanup.

Ingredients:

  • Salmon fillets
  • Broccoli florets
  • Bell peppers, sliced
  • Red potatoes, diced
  • Olive oil
  • Garlic, minced
  • Lemon zest
  • Dried herbs (such as thyme, rosemary, or dill)
  • Salt and pepper

Instructions:

  1. To begin cooking, pre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C). Position the salmon fillets at the centre of a baking sheet.
  2. Surround the salmon with broccoli florets, sliced bell peppers, and diced red potatoes.
  3. In a petite bowl, mix olive oil and minced garlic, lemon zest, dried herbs, salt, and pepper, and mix well.
  4. Drizzle this oil mixture evenly over the salmon and vegetables.
  5. To cook the salmon and vegetables, To bake your dish, put the baking sheet in the oven and cook for approximately 15-20 minutes. Until the salmon is cooked properly and the vegetables have become tender.
  6. Overnight Oats:

Start your day with a nutritious and hassle-free breakfast. Overnight oats are customizable and can be prepared the night before for a quick morning meal.

Ingredients:

  • Rolled oats
  • Greek yoghurt
  • Milk (dairy or plant-based)
  • Chia seeds
  • Honey or maple syrup
  • Fresh fruits (such as berries, banana slices, or diced apples)
  • Nuts or seeds for topping
  • Instructions:
  1. Mix rolled oats, Greek yoghurt, and milk; place chia seeds and a bit of honey or maple syrup into a jar or container.
  2. Stir thoroughly to make sure the oats are completely soaked in the liquid.
  3. Layer fresh fruits on top of the mixture.
  4. Seal the pot and place it in the refrigerator overnight.
  5. The following day, give the oats a good stir, and for some added crunch, toss in some nuts or seeds before savouring your breakfast!
